**Wiki access, quick refresher.** On Fernwick's docs wiki, roles cascade: Viewer < Contributor < Maintainer. If someone on support can't edit the Outage Playbooks space, check whether they got Contributor on the parent space or just the page — page-level grants don't inherit downward, which trips people up constantly. Don't hand out Maintainer unless Priya's team signs off. If a permission change doesn't stick after five minutes, the sync job probably stalled; restart it from the admin panel and verify against the build shown below.

build token for yajof-bajof: htk31_506ff1188f74596b5bb2eec94edc43c

# Staxley Environments

Quick refresher for support folks: Staxley handles incremental static site rebuilds, so when a customer edits one page, we only rebuild that page and anything linking to it — not the whole site. We run three environments: sandbox, staging, and prod. Sandbox rebuilds everything on every push (on purpose, for testing), staging mirrors prod behaviour, and prod is the real deal. If a customer says "my change isn't showing," check which environment first. Each environment uses the following rebuild settings.

config for kafof-bawef:
holath:
  log_level: debug
  metrics_host: metrics.holath.qorvelsys.internal
  pin: 2191
  pool_size: 32

## Break-Glass Access — SproutCycle Scheduler

If SproutCycle's watering queue stalls and both admins at Fernvale Labs are unreachable, use the break-glass flow. First confirm the stall: greenhouse zones report no dispatch events for 30+ minutes. Then open the emergency console on the scheduler host and select "Override Session." Log every action in the on-call journal; the override bypasses the dual-approval rule, so accuracy matters. When prompted, enter the recovery passphrase exactly as written below, including spacing and case.

strongbox words: norwyn-wenael-aldvan-aldiel-wendor-holael

Handover: Crashlet pipeline (Vexa app). Ingest runs on the Parrow cluster; symbolication worker retries twice, then dead-letters. Watch the dedupe queue after each release — it backs up if the symbol upload lags. Marit owns alerting; ping her before touching thresholds. Runbook, dashboards, and the dead-letter drain script are all on the wiki page.

wiki page, yajep-taweg: https://gitlab.zemvarsys.corp/spaces/dash/pages/36fc5fc27c64